Methods: A review was conducted identifying relevant published articles involving snake bite management and treatment in PubMed and EMBASE. Results: One hundred ten articles were identified and 77 met inclusion criteria. Snake bite envenomation can result ... Five of the 16 were Russell’s viper bites (two contractures, three with scar formation and three amputations), and 11 were Merrem’s hump-nosed viper bites (two contractures, ... one year after the snake bite, there were 37/168 (22%) patients with non-specific symptoms and 14/168 (8%) with symptoms related to the oral cavity. Jul 1, 2019 · Despite his expertise and prudence, Terry “the Snake Man” Vandeventer bears a 13 ½-inch-long, 2 ½ -inch-wide scar on his right arm and hand, a 38-year-old reminder of rattlesnake bite. “I messed up,” said Vandeventer, a herpetology field associate with the Mississippi Museum of Natural Science.

When it comes to venomous snakes, "time is tissue" according to Dr ...Reticulated python teeth hold no venom. But they can still do some damage. If you suffer a reticulated python bite and the snake detaches itself, the slender fangs scarcely leave a scar. But if the snake is forcefully removed, the wounds can be much more severe, thanks to the curved teeth. The snake usually bites as a form of defense.

Armed with the knowledge of these symptoms, some questions still remain.Snakebite, First Aid. There are 2 kinds of snakebites: poisonous (venomous) and nonpoisonous (nonvenomous). Most snakes are nonpoisonous, and bites from such snakes can be treated as puncture wounds. First aid for puncture wounds can be found in the Wound text. Poisonous snakebites are much less common but much more …94,000–125,000 per year [3] A snakebite is an injury caused by the bite of a snake, especially a venomous snake. [9] A common sign of a bite from a venomous snake is the presence of two puncture wounds from the animal's fangs. [1] Sometimes venom injection from the bite may occur. Go to: skyward lubbock cooper Nov 4, 2023 · Snake bites in Arizona occur about 250 to 350 times a year. Since 2002, there have been five deaths in Arizona as a result of a snake bite. However, deaths from snake bites are rare, and snake bites can be avoided. The rattlesnake habitat is ideal in Arizona because of its hot, dry climate.
